My privacy policy was violated @ a local cash advance. Does anyone know a 1-800 # so I can report them.?
Question:
Answer:
Contact your state's Financial Institutions Division (FID)..They are the regulators for cash advance stores. If your state doesn't have specific laws protecting your rights, you are still protected by federal law. The FID should be able to point you in the right direction for who to contact federally.
